Changes of Santun River and Hutubi River (Xinjiang, China) in the Past 300 Years

Abstract: The changes of river system in the Arid Area are major aspects of env ironmental evolvement and are related to other aspects closely. To research the process of rivers system changes is the first step to study the environmental evolvement of the Arid Area. The watercourse location of Santun River and Hutubi River was reconstructed in different historical periods by re-analysis on historic al materials, historical maps, historical files, being combined with the modern scientific achievements on climatology, hydrology and remote sensing images. The main results are (1) Santun River and Hutubi River belonged to one river system, which was one of inpouring rivers to Manas Lake before 20thcentury; (2) Santun River and Hutubi River were apart in the first 20 years of 20thcentury due to the reduction of the two rivers' current and the change of the rivers' courses; (3) all courses of Santun River and Hutubi River were fixed by Human being in the last 50 years; (4) precipitation changes in the north slope of Tianshan Mountain play the main role in the river system changes of Santun River and Hutubi River in the end of 19thcentury and at the beginning of 20thcentury; (5) human activiy is the main cause of the river system changes of Santun River and Hutubi River in the last 50 years.
